APPENDIX A<br />
Definitions<br />
Air Sentry<br />
An individual designated by the Officer in Charge (OIC) of<br />
Firing to maintain surveillance of an assigned sector of<br />
airspace to warn of the approach of aircraft.<br />
Artillery Firing<br />
Area<br />
Area established to support artillery firing activities.<br />
<strong>Base</strong><br />
<strong>Marine</strong> <strong>Corps</strong> <strong>Base</strong>, <strong>Camp</strong> <strong>Pendleton</strong> (MCB, CamPen).<br />
<strong>Camp</strong> <strong>Pendleton</strong><br />
Amphibious Assault<br />
Area (CPAAA)<br />
An ocean area used for amphibious training activities and<br />
exercises.<br />
<strong>Camp</strong> <strong>Pendleton</strong><br />
Amphibious Vehicle<br />
Area (CPAVA)<br />
An area contained within CPAAA. It is adjacent to the<br />
shoreline and used for amphibious training activities.<br />
Cantonment<br />
An area assigned for administrative and logistical<br />
functions, such as housing, troop billeting, offices,<br />
storage and maintenance areas. Normally, field training<br />
and live-firing are not conducted within cantonment areas.<br />
Common Impact Area<br />
The impact area created when the surface danger zones<br />
(SDZs) of concurrently used ranges overlap.<br />
Confined Area<br />
Landing Site<br />
(CALSITE)<br />
Helicopter landing areas located in <strong>Camp</strong> <strong>Pendleton</strong><br />
training areas used for confined area landing practice,<br />
external training, etc.<br />
Consolidated<br />
Radar Control<br />
Facility (CRCF)<br />
<strong>Marine</strong> <strong>Corps</strong> <strong>Base</strong> and <strong>Marine</strong> <strong>Corps</strong> Air Station <strong>Camp</strong><br />
<strong>Pendleton</strong> Air Traffic Control and Range Control Facility,<br />
BLDG 2399, <strong>Marine</strong> <strong>Corps</strong> Air Station, <strong>Camp</strong> <strong>Pendleton</strong>.<br />
Location of LONGRIFLE.<br />
Controlled Firing<br />
Area (CFA)<br />
Airspace established to conduct activities that would be<br />
hazardous to non-participating aircraft if not conducted<br />
in a controlled environment. It is the range user’s<br />
responsibility to provide for the safety of persons and<br />
property on the surface and to cease firing when aircraft<br />
transit the CFA.<br />
